A Quiet Win in the Skinny Budget—Now Let’s Get Strategic

Here’s something we don’t often get to say during budget season: there’s no bad news.

The President’s recently released “skinny” budget doesn’t propose eliminating or reducing funding for Head Start. That’s a win—especially in a time when so many programs face deep scrutiny or even defunding in early drafts. For many in the Head Start world, it’s a welcome relief.

As the Virginia Head Start Association (VHSA) recently put it:

“This is good news… It means we will likely not see any proposal to eliminate Head Start.”

As NHSA Executive Director Yasmina Vinci also noted, this development reflects the impact of strong, unified advocacy. “Thousands of messages, calls, and actions from the Head Start community helped ensure this program remains protected—for now.”

However, she also cautioned that the budget includes deep cuts to other key programs—making the final outcome for Head Start funding far from certain. It’s a reminder that this is a moment to stay engaged, not disengaged.

This is where strategy counts.

What’s the Catch?

While Head Start programs may be safe from cuts—for now—they’re also not getting additional funding to match rising operational costs. And those costs are real:

  • Staffing and wages are up

  • Administrative and compliance burdens have grown

  • Inflation affects everything from food to facilities

  • Expectations around data, family engagement, coordination, and continuous improvement continue to rise

In other words, flat funding is not flat pressure.

Let’s Talk Strategy

This isn’t a time to panic—it’s a time to plan smartly and act intentionally. Programs must prepare for flat funding as the most likely outcome, with the possibility of modest cuts depending on final congressional decisions.

That means asking the tough but necessary questions:

  • Where are we duplicating effort with outdated or disconnected tools?

  • Are our systems designed for real performance—or just meeting minimum compliance?

  • What costs are we maintaining that don’t actually serve our mission?

Now is the time to:

  • Model multiple budget scenarios, including level funding and potential reductions (-1%, -3%)

  • Streamline operations, especially in administrative functions

  • Eliminate inefficiencies in software, systems, and subscriptions

  • Invest in sustainability—tools and processes that reduce effort over time

It’s time to shift from “getting by” to building resilience.
